CONCEPT OF VAMANA (EMESIS) BY SUKSHMA TAMRARAJA (FINE POWDER OF COPPER SULPHATE) IN GARAVISHA (CONCOCTED POISON) CHIKITSA (TREATMENT) W.R.T. MODERN SCIENCE

Journal Title: International Journal of Ayurveda & Alternative Medicine - Year 2017, Vol 5, Issue 4

Abstract

Garavisha (Concoted poison) as per classics can be considered as any part of the body tissue, waste products, Bhasmas (ashes) of Viruddhaaushadhi (incompatible drugs), drug or poison having less potency, pulverized bodies of the insects, etc. It interferes with the digestion and affects the whole body by vitiating all the Dhatus (tissues) in the body and produces deleterious effects over a period of accumulation and is considered to be fatal in time. Tamra (Copper) has been known from prehistoric times and has been employed in making tools and different types of utensils, from the 12th century onwards the reference for the preparation and use of Tamra (Copper) is available. Now a days, copper is given by physicians only in bhasma (calcined) form, that too under strict medical supervision. It is indicated that the patient of Garavisha (Concoted poison) should instantaneously be given Vamana (emetic therapy) by the physician as Emesis is regarded as the best one among all the therapeutic measures for the poison taken orally. Vamana karma (emesis therapy) by Sukshma Tamra Raja (fine powder of copper sulphate) with honey is indicated in Garavisha (Concocted poison) Chikitsa (treatment), which expels the accumulated toxins. After the heart is cleansed the patient should be given one Shana of the Bhasma (fine powder) of gold to destroy all kinds of poison within the body & for the protection of Heart.
